Output 5d95705353da3827910a54e2dc6ae4e2b6b3a09e2695930d96afc849abcbfc4b:3

value
8417345
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c5d442b5509b7bc61d009302725b78d05076259122ce7d7c445d43c8eb50a1a
address
tb1pe3w5g264pxmmccwspyczwfdh35zswcjezgkw047ygh2rer44pgdq97amvn
transaction
5d95705353da3827910a54e2dc6ae4e2b6b3a09e2695930d96afc849abcbfc4b
spent
false